Step 1

Explain gene flow

Gene flow involves the transfer of alleles between populations through mechanisms such as migration. When individuals from one population migrate to another and breed, they introduce new alleles to the gene pool, altering allele frequencies. This can enhance genetic diversity and may lead to the adaptation of the population to new environments.

Step 2

Explain genetic drift

Genetic drift refers to random changes in allele frequencies within a population due to chance events. This is particularly significant in small populations where random events can have a larger impact. For example, if a particular allele becomes more prevalent simply by chance, it can lead to evolutionary changes over time, potentially reducing genetic variation and affecting the population's ability to adapt.
